]> code.delx.au - gnu-emacs/blobdiff - lisp/calc/calc-store.el
(calc-sec, calc-csc, calc-cot, calc-sech, calc-csch, calc-coth)
[gnu-emacs] / lisp / calc / calc-store.el
index 9323952180144a49596f16a359948f12079e9c6d..52f0cc0272d6600dd9345a17a64ee0303ec5c186 100644 (file)
 
 (defun calcVar-digit ()
   (interactive)
-  (if (calc-minibuffer-contains "var-\\'")
+  (if (calc-minibuffer-contains "\\'")
       (if (eq calc-store-opers 0)
          (beep)
        (insert "q")
 (defun calcVar-oper ()
   (interactive)
   (if (and (eq calc-store-opers t)
-          (calc-minibuffer-contains "var-\\'"))
+          (calc-minibuffer-contains "\\'"))
       (progn
        (erase-buffer)
        (self-insert-and-exit))
         (setq calc-last-edited-variable var)
         (calc-edit-mode (list 'calc-finish-stack-edit (list 'quote var))
                         t
-                        (concat "Editing " (calc-var-name var)))
+                        (concat "Editing variable `" (calc-var-name var) "'. "))
         (and value
              (insert (math-format-nice-expr value (frame-width)) "\n")))))
   (calc-show-edit-buffer))
                             (setq rp nil)))
                       (not rp)))))
      (calc-unread-command ?\C-a)
-     (setq decl (read-string (format "Declare: %s  to be: " var)
+     (setq decl (read-string (format "Declare: %s  to be: " (calc-var-name var))
                             (and rp
                                  (math-format-flat-expr (nth 2 (car dp)) 0))))
      (setq decl (and (string-match "[^ \t]" decl)